EPA Proposed Limits on PFAS Forever Chemicals in Drinking Water

The long-anticipated rules on the chemicals that don’t biodegrade easily have been expected for months.
March 14, 2023

As several chemical producers phase out production of polyfluoroalkyl substances (PFAS), federal regulators are setting new rules on how much of them are safe in drinking water, rules that could ripple through the manufacturing world as chemical producers could become responsible for cleanup.
